The year is 1956. The Cold War casts a long shadow, Elvis Presley is topping the charts, and Rolex is solidifying its position as a titan of the watchmaking world. This year marks a significant point in the history of a legendary timepiece: the Rolex Submariner. While a specific "1956" model designation doesn't exist in the same way later models do, understanding the Submariner's evolution in the mid-1950s is crucial to appreciating its enduring legacy. This exploration delves into the context surrounding the 1956 era, examining the Submariner's development, its early iterations, and its lasting impact on the world of diving and horology.

Rolex's commitment to crafting instruments for professional use became increasingly evident from the early 1950s. The brand wasn't content with simply creating elegant dress watches; they were pushing the boundaries of what a timepiece could achieve, developing watches designed to withstand the rigors of extreme environments. This ambition, coupled with advancements in watchmaking technology, laid the groundwork for the creation of the Submariner. Further details on Rolex's development during this period, specifically from 1953 to 1967, can be found on the official Rolex website (rolex.com), offering a comprehensive overview of the brand's innovation and growth.

The Submariner wasn't just another watch; it was revolutionary. It represented a significant leap forward in diving technology, providing a reliable and accurate timekeeping solution for professional divers. Before its arrival, divers often relied on less robust and less precise instruments, putting their safety at risk. The Submariner, with its robust construction and water resistance, changed all that. Its introduction marked the beginning of a new era in diving, where accurate timekeeping was no longer a luxury but a necessity. This pioneering spirit is what distinguishes the early Submariners, and those produced around 1956, from their successors.

The Genesis of a Legend: Pre-1956 Submariners and the 6204/6205

While 1956 doesn't correspond to a specific model number, understanding the Submariner's evolution leading up to that year is vital. The first Submariner, reference 6204, appeared in 1953. This model, with its relatively simple design and 3-piece case, already showcased the brand's dedication to waterproofness and durability. Its successor, the reference 6205, introduced slight refinements, further enhancing its performance and reliability. These early Submariners, produced in the years leading up to 1956, laid the foundation for the iconic design that would become synonymous with the name. These early models are highly sought after by collectors today, representing the raw, unadorned beginnings of a legendary watch.
